show ethernet-switching table

date_range 22-Nov-24

Syntax (Products that support the Enhanced Layer 2 Software (ELS))

content_copy zoom_out_map
show ethernet-switching table
<brief | count | detail | extensive | summary>
<address>
<instance instance-name>
<interface interface-name>
isid isid
<logical-system logical-system-name>
<persistent-learning (interface interface-name | mac mac-address)>
<vlan-id (all-vlan | vlan-id)>
<vlan-name (all | vlan-name)>

Syntax (Products that do not support ELS, Except MX Series Routers)

content_copy zoom_out_map
show ethernet-switching table
<brief | detail | extensive | summary>
<interface interface-name>
<management-vlan>
<persistent-mac <interface interface-name>>
<sort-by (name | tag)>
<vlan vlan-name>
Note:

MX Series routers support the show bridge mac-table command in place of this command. For the syntax on MX Series routers, see show bridge mac-table.

Description

Displays the Ethernet switching table.

Displays Layer 2 MAC address information.

Options

For products that support ELS:

none

Display all learned Layer 2 MAC address information.

brief | count | detail | extensive | summary

(Optional) Display the specified level of output.

address

(Optional) Display the specified learned Layer 2 MAC address information.

instance instance-name

(Optional) Display learned Layer 2 MAC addresses for the specified routing instance.

interface interface-name

(Optional) Display learned Layer 2 MAC addresses for the specified interface.

isid isid

(Optional) Display learned Layer 2 MAC addresses for the specified ISID.

logical-system logical-system-name

(Optional) Display Ethernet-switching statistics information for the specified logical system.

persistent-learning (interface interface-name | mac mac-address)

(Optional) Display dynamically learned MAC addresses that are retained despite device restarts and interface failures for a specified interface, or information about a specified MAC address.

vlan-id (all-vlan | vlan-id)

(Optional) Display learned Layer 2 MAC addresses for all VLANs or for the specified VLAN.

vlan-name (all | vlan-name)

(Optional) Display learned Layer 2 MAC addresses for all VLANs or for the specified VLAN.

For products that do not support ELS:

none

(Optional) Display brief information about the Ethernet switching table.

brief | detail | extensive | summary

(Optional) Display the specified level of output.

interface interface-name

(Optional) Display the Ethernet switching table for a specific interface.

management-vlan

(Optional) Display the Ethernet switching table for a management VLAN.

persistent-mac <interface interface-name>

(Optional) Display the persistent MAC addresses learned for all interfaces or a specified interface. You can use this command to view entries that you want to clear for an interface that you intentionally disabled.

sort-by (name | tag)

(Optional) Display VLANs in ascending order of VLAN IDs or VLAN names.

vlan vlan-name

(Optional) Display the Ethernet switching table for a specific VLAN.

Additional Information

When Layer 2 protocol tunneling is enabled, the tunneling MAC address 01:00:0c:cd:cd:d0 is installed in the MAC table. When the Cisco Discovery Protocol (CDP), Spanning Tree Protocol (STP), or VLAN Trunk Protocol (VTP) is configured for Layer 2 protocol tunneling on an interface, the corresponding protocol MAC address is installed in the MAC table.

Required Privilege Level

view

Output Fields

For products that support ELS: The table describes the output fields for the show ethernet-switching table command on products that support ELS. Output fields are listed in the approximate order in which they appear.

Table 1: show ethernet-switching table Output fields on Products That Support ELS

Field Name

Field Description

Routing instance

Name of the routing instance.

VLAN name

Name of the VLAN.

MAC address

MAC address or addresses learned on a logical interface.

MAC flags

Status of MAC address learning properties for each interface:

  • S—Static MAC address is configured.

  • D—Dynamic MAC address is configured.

  • L—Locally learned MAC address is configured.

  • SE—MAC accounting is enabled.

  • NM—Non-configured MAC.

  • R—Remote PE MAC address is configured.

  • O—OVSDB learned MAC address is configured.

  • B—Blocked duplicate MAC address.

Age

This field is not supported.

Logical interface

Name of the logical interface.

Name of the VTEP logical interface learned over remote VTEP.

GBP Tag

Assigned Group Based Policy (GBP) from 1 through 65535.

SVLBNH/VENH Index

Note:

This field appears on QFX5XXX switches that support dynamic load balancing in an EVPN-VXLAN network.

Next-hop index number associated with the MAC address of a multihomed remote device in an EVPN-VXLAN network. This index number appears when the Logical Interface column displays esi.nnnn. The index number can be an SVLBNH, a VENH, or a remote virtual tunnel endpoint (VTEP). To get more information about SVLBNHs, VENHs, and remote VTEPs, see show ethernet-switching vxlan-tunnel-end-point svlbnh.

Active source

IP address or Ethernet segment identifier (ESI) of remote entity on which MAC address is learned.

MAC count

Number of MAC addresses learned on the specific routing instance or interface.

Learning interface

Name of the logical interface on which the MAC address was learned.

Learning VLAN

VLAN ID of the routing instance or VLAN in which the MAC address was learned.

Layer 2 flags

Debugging flags signifying that the MAC address is present in various lists.

Epoch

Spanning-tree-protocolepoch number identifying when the MAC address was learned. Used for debugging.

Sequence number

Sequence number assigned to this MAC address. Used for debugging.

Learning mask

Mask of the Packet Forwarding Engines where this MAC address was learned. Used for debugging.

IPC generation

Creation time of the logical interface when this MAC address was learned. Used for debugging.

For products that do not support ELS: The following table lists the output fields for the show ethernet-switching table command on products that do not support ELS. Output fields are listed in the approximate order in which they appear.

Table 2: show ethernet-switching table Output Fields on Products That Do Not Support ELS

Field Name

Field Description

Level of Output

VLAN

The name of a VLAN.

All levels

Tag

The VLAN ID tag name or number.

extensive

MAC or MAC address

The MAC address associated with the VLAN.

All levels

Type

The type of MAC address. Values are:

  • static—The MAC address is manually created.

  • learn—The MAC address is learned dynamically from a packet's source MAC address.

  • flood—The MAC address is unknown and flooded to all members.

  • persistent—The learned MAC addresses that will persist across restarts of the switch or interface-down events.

All levels except persistent-mac

Type

The type of MAC address. Values are:

  • installed—addresses that are in the Ethernet switching table.

  • uninstalled—addresses that could not be installed in the table or were uninstalled in an interface-down event and will be reinstalled in the table when the interface comes back up.

persistent-mac

Age

The time remaining before the entry ages out and is removed from the Ethernet switching table.

All levels

Interfaces

Interface associated with learned MAC addresses or All-members (flood entry).

All levels

Learned

For learned entries, the time which the entry was added to the Ethernet switching table.

detail, extensive

Nexthop index

The next-hop index number.

detail, extensive

persistent-mac

installed indicates MAC addresses that are in the Ethernet switching table and uninstalled indicates MAC addresses that could not be installed in the table or were uninstalled in an interface-down event (and will be reinstalled in the table when the interface comes back up).

Release Information

Command introduced in Junos OS Release 9.0 for EX Series switches.

Command introduced in Junos OS Release 9.5 for SRX Series.

Options summary, management-vlan, and vlan vlan-name introduced in Junos OS Release 9.6 for EX Series switches.

Option sort-by and field name tag introduced in Junos OS Release 10.1 for EX Series switches.

Command introduced in Junos OS Release 11.1 for the QFX Series.

Output for private VLANs introduced in Junos OS Release 12.1 for the QFX Series.

Option persistent-mac introduced in Junos OS Release 11.4 for EX Series switches.

Command introduced in Junos OS Release 12.3R2.

ELS commands introduced in Junos OS Release 12.3R2 for EX Series switches.

Options logical-system, persistent-learning, and summary introduced in Junos OS Release 13.2X50-D10 (ELS).

Output for shared VXLAN load balancing next hop (SVLBNH) and VXLAN encapsulated next hop (VENH) introduced in Junos OS Release 20.3R1 for QFX Series switches.

Output for pseudo VTEP logical interfaces introduced in Junos OS Release 20.3R1 for QFX Series switches.

GBP Tag option introduced in Junos OS Release 22.4R1 for supported QFX5120, EX4100, EX4400, and EX4650 Series switches.
